The Mission of the TMBC Men's Ministry
Our mission is to provide a forum for men of ages 18 and above for sharing, fellowship, learning and outreach services that follows the mandate of Christ.
About The Men's Ministry
100 Trinity Men. Upon any time of being called, 100 Men of Trinity Missionary Baptist Church can be mobilized to serve the kingdom in activities that center around Fellowship, Church Ministries, Male Mentoring and Community Outreach.

100 Trinity Men does not mean the TMBC Men's Fellowship is limited to 100 Men. It's about building a ministry of believers who strive to strengthen Christian Faith. It's about developing and expressing a personal desire for spiritual growth with a solid foundation of Sunday School, Bible Study, Men's Retreats, Prayer Meetings, Christian Education Classes, Monthly Fellowship and theological study via the Church Library.
It is through this foundation coupled with our love of God, that whether it be 10, 50, 100 or 500 men, Trinity Missionary Baptist Church can count on 100 Trinity Men to be mobilized to promote the kingdom

Simba Young Lions
A Christian Based Male Mentoring and Rites of Passage Program
Purpose
This program is designed to instill pride and hope in our male youths (ages 8 – 18) and provide them with the knowledge, skills and ability to face the challenges of being a Christian man in our society as they transition from adolescences into adulthood.
Program dynamics/Location
The program conducts twice monthly, Saturday morning sessions, on a variety of topics pertinent to the development of young males. Most sessions will be held at the Trinity Missionary Baptist Church Family Life Center, 119-123 Wesson Street, Pontiac, Michigan. Sessions begin promptly at 9:00AM and end at 11:00AM
The curriculum
The curriculum is designed to enhance, reinforce, and solidify the lessons that young men should be receiving at school and at home. We work on an “open book” basis, meaning there are no secrets and all of our material is open to review by parents or guardians at any time.
